| Since the reform and opening up,China has participated in the global value chain to achieve rapid economic growth and industrial upgrading,while there are still "lowend high-end industries" and "high-tech is not high",and face the severe challenge of "two-way squeeze".With the deepening of division of labor in global value chain,is participation in global value chain really beneficial to the improvement of technological innovation capability of Chinese manufacturing industry? What is the impact mechanism of China’s embedding in GVCS on technological innovation? What factors have a positive moderating effect on the relationship between GVC embedding and technological innovation? Answering the above questions is of great theoretical and practical significance for China to realize industrial upgrading and promote highquality economic development in the next stage.The research of this paper follows the research ideas of theoretical analysis,empirical analysis and policy suggestions.As a whole is divided into the following steps: firstly,this paper reviews the existing domestic and foreign research on global value chain and its relationship with technological innovation.Secondly,based on the theory of product division and comparative advantage,theoretical analysis and research hypothesis are proposed.Meanwhile,the status quo of China’s manufacturing industry’s participation in the global value chain and the evolution of technological innovation is analyzed.Thirdly,this paper uses the bidirectional fixed effects model and selects GVC participation and manufacturing industry innovation index,which can distinguish forward and backward as well as complexity,as explanatory variables and explained variables respectively,to analyze the mechanism of GVC embedding on technological innovation.In addition,based on the heterogeneity of the industry,multiple groups of grouping regression and robustness tests were performed.Finally,the conclusions are summarized and corresponding policy suggestions are put forward.The results show that:(1)The backward participation of the global value chain of China’s manufacturing industry is higher than the forward participation,and there is still more backward embedding into the global division of labor system,so China plays a role in "value input" in foreign trade,but in recent years this role is gradually changing to "value output".(2)In the sample study period,the backward participation of China’s manufacturing industry into the global value chain division of labor will have a negative impact on the domestic manufacturing technology innovation,while the forward participation will have a significant positive effect on the technology innovation.(3)According to the difference of industry factor endowment,the stage difference after the financial crisis,and the heterogeneity of industrial policy implementation of manufacturing subsectors,the relationship between GVC and innovation has different impacts from backward or forward participation.(4)This paper examines the moderating effects of technology absorption capacity and producer services input on technological innovation.The regression results show that both producer services input has a positive moderating effect on technological innovation,and technology absorption capacity has a significant positive moderating effect on backward participation.As for forward embedding,due to the lack of technology transformation ability in China,the new knowledge gained in embedding global value chain cannot be effectively utilized and its own unique innovative technology can be formed.In view of this,this paper puts forward some policy suggestions,such as accelerating the development of high-tech industry,perfecting the industrial policy system and improving the domestic technology absorption and conversion capacity. |
